I work overnight cashier at a grocery store. I'm in from 10 pm to 6 am the next day. It's an okay job. Not soul destroying, not particularly pleasant. Part of working Third Shift is you interact with all the wierdo's, homeless, drug addicts, and pot heads you won't see during the day. By in large, they tend to be harmless- high and drunk people come into the store all the time, buy their munchies and beer and cigarettes, and leave. And they're polite, even.
 
Today, one of them tried to cut his own throat.
 
I wasn't around for the first part of it. The baker, lets call him "Jim", said he heard something glass break, and he comes out of the food prep area and see's a guy just standing there, over a broken jug of wine. The guy looks at him and says, "God is good." Then he drags a sliver of glass acrossed his neck. It's too small and doesn't cut. Jim grabs the guys wrists and tries to calm him down, a struggle ensues.
 
The guy who cleans and buffs our floors at night is latino. He doesnt' speak great english. He communicated to me someone needed help by the bakery- so I figure someone dropped or broke something and I gotta clean the floor. I see Jim and Drunk guy going at it Kirk and Spock style- Jim's holding the guys arms and trying to wrestle him away from the glass, Drunk guy is going for the glass. Drunk Guy gets ahold of a broken top piece of the wine bottle, Jim wresltes him to the floor pinning him, screaming "Help me, he's trying to fucking kill himself, help me!"
 
Once I figure out i'm not being punked I go the hell over there. I try to grab the guys arm, the free one holding the broken bottle. He jams it into his throat and starts sawing, just gouging it in. Blood spurts out everywhere and covers the floor. I'm trying to pull it away but can't Drunk guy gurgles and starts to vomit face down in his own blood. I scream for Jim to squeeze the guys neck and put pressure on it, someone yells for someone to call 911, I break out my cell phone (In clear violation of store policy, employees aren't even supposed to carry them. Take that, Corporate) and deliver a panicked call to 911. Then another, when I worry the message didn't get through.
 
Police, Firemen, and EMT's arrive - in that order. Took about five minutes. The EMT's had the guy out lickety split, last I heard they stabilized him and transferred him to medical. We spend about another two and a half hours there while the police tape the area off, get detectives there, take statements from us, and the Store manager shows up to compile the security footage to give them.
